When teachers are supported, classrooms transform.
This video shows how teachers using LeadNowโ€”a digital teacher professional development and coaching toolkit developed by Dignitasโ€”are strengthening how they plan and deliver lessons in real classrooms.

With continuous, practical support, teachers move from feeling overwhelmed in large, diverse classrooms to confidently planning inclusive lessons that reach every learner.

The result is more confident teachers and more engaged learners. Through the Mastercard Foundation EdTech Fellowship, this work has been strengthened through collaboration and learning with other innovators.

Improving learning outcomes requires a system that is aligned, responsive, and working together.

Last week, this came to life as we joined partners across the ๐€๐‹๐ข๐•๐„ ๐๐ซ๐จ๐ ๐ซ๐š๐ฆ๐ฆ๐ž for a 3-day ๐—ฅ๐—˜๐—Ÿ๐—œ ๐—”๐—ณ๐—ฟ๐—ถ๐—ฐ๐—ฎ convening, bringing together government and education actors advancing life skills and values-based education. The ALiVE Programme focuses on ensuring children gain the skills and values they need to thrive in school, work, and life.

As an implementing partner, our work in Isiolo focuses on supporting teachers through training and coaching to integrate these skills into everyday teaching and learning.

But strong classroom practice is just the starting point. For this work to last and reach more learners, it needs to be supported across the system through:

โœ”๏ธ Alignment across education actors
โœ”๏ธ Use of evidence to inform decisions
โœ”๏ธ Coordination between policy, schools, and communities
โœ”๏ธ Sustained system-level support

This is what it takes to move from strong teaching in individual classrooms to lasting impact for all learners.
